TopSolid'Cam at Industrie 2006 |
Missler Software will be present at the all important trade fair Industrie 2006 in Paris, 27-31 March. This is a leading French industrial trade fair for Missler Software who is considered the number 2 CAD/CAM editor in France. TopSolid'Cam 2006 will be the main highlight of the show with the principal new functionalities of this new version being on display:
- The automatic transformation of 3 axis tool paths in 5 axis tool paths – This function automates the transformation of a 3axis tool path into a 5 axis tool path and is a significant improvement for mold makers. It permits the use of shorter tools to machine the part, which in turn favours good cutting conditions, a decrease in possible vibrations and a significant reduction in cycle times.
- The emptying of « 5 axis » pockets – TopSolid'Cam 2006 automates the emptying of « 5 axis » pockets which in turn considerably reduces the number of steps necessary to perform this action. The new version of TopSolid'Cam automatically evacuates the holes followed by a pocket wall finishing using the swarf machining technique. This new function is particularly interesting in the aeronautical field where speed and reactivity are essential.
- Drilling on « wire-frame » geometry – This new function allows the machining of identical holes, not modelled in the CAD file and which have different orientations. In addition, it enables faster 5 axis drilling. This automated function is, for example, an important addition for clockmakers.
- Production Management – TopSolid'Cam 2006 gives the operator the possibility to manage his production by « assembling » several different parts and their machining processes on the same machine. In other words, the operator can assemble parts already programmed without the need to re-programme the parts. This new function gives the operator the opportunity to really manage his production. In the case of a machine breakdown, he can change machine without re-programming his parts. This function also reduces production cycles by simultaneously manufacturing different products without having programming problems.
- Swiss turn machining made easier – TopSolid'Cam 2006 offers turning cycles adapted to Swiss turn lathes. In fact, all turning cycles such as roughing, finishing, breakdown … have been adapted to the Swiss turning process. This new function offers significant gains for Swiss turning operations.
- Tool length management by separating 3D machining processes - This improvement in TopSolid'Cam 2006 allows mold makers make surface and cutting condition improvements. This function automatically divides the machining operations in such a way that they are carried out by both a short and long tool. In this way, cutting conditions are optimised and cycle times are reduced.
- Deep drilling – TopSolid'Cam 2006 manages ¾ gun drills used for deep drillings. This new function offers special cycles for ¾ gun drills which are mainly used by mold makers in the drilling of cooling circuits in mold plates.

TopSolid'Cam for the aeronautical industry |
TopSolid'Cam is the leading CAM software used by aeronautical sub-contractors in France. Many of the main Airbus sub-contractors use TopSolid notably for its superior 5 axis machining. So let's take a closer look at why TopSolid'Cam responds so well to the needs of this sector.
Exceptional quality is a key element in the aeronautical sector. In general, aeronautical parts are made up of many pockets (cavities). The walls between these pockets are often very thin. In addition, these walls are not always vertical and therefore need to be machined in 5 axis continuous. Also noteworthy in aeronautical parts is the fact that they are machined on all sides so that they are as light as possible.
Let's look at some of the reasons why TopSolid'Cam is an ideal solution for the machining of aeronautical parts:
- Topological analysis – the pockets are automatically recognized as are the bottom layers. This permits the use of a torique mill with automatic detection of the corners.
- Management of the stock – Management of the stock, permits among other things, validation of a machining process by inversing the machining operations. TopSolid'Cam knows where the material is located and automatically adapts machining operations taking this into account. This is an important factor for all parts that are heavily worked on or where the machining process is delicate. It represents an important time gain for operators and a guarantee that the most appropriate machining operation is chosen for the given stock.
- Cycles by pockets or by Z level – to ensure the correct machining of pockets with fine walls (widespread in aeronautics), special cycles called Z level cycles, are necessary to prevent the parts becoming too fragile. TopSolid'Cam offers such Z level machining which assures the structure of the part.
- Dedicated cycles to “surface quality” – In some cases the slightest Z movement by the tool causes unacceptable marks. TopSolid is capable of performing “finished pocket” cycles which minimise this problem by minimising tool jumping. This guarantees such high surface quality as demanded in the manufacturing of satellites for example (Alcatel Espace is a TopSolid'Cam customer)
- Part positioning – To find out if it is possible to machine a part with a particular machine TopSolid'Cam is capable of measuring the geometry of the part and defining which faces can and cannot be machined – this is in fact 5 axis positioned machining.
- Swarf machining – This machining process allows the creation of curved sides in 5 axis continuous. Such curved sides are found in aeronautical fastenings and compressor impellors.
- Collision management – TopSolid'Cam permits collisions to be prevented between the part and the tool. Such collision management is essential in aeronautics due to the complexity and the price of parts.
- Panoply Production – Panoply machining (i.e. machining of identical parts where machining processes are repeated) is greatly facilitated as it suffices to program a part and its machining schedule which will automatically machine a line of products. This is important in aeronautics where there are large quantities of products to finish in a short period of time.

Missler Software has recently appointed the company Encons as a new reseller in East Germany. Encons will work with GOelan - Missler Software's CAM stand alone product.
GOelan is a CAD/CAM software for the design and machining of mechanical parts in milling, turning and wire electroerosion. GOelan is an easy to use software which enables programming of numerically controlled machines directly from the factory floor. For further information please visit www.goelan.info.
Encons is no stranger to the CAD/CAM world having already worked with Missler Software resellers in Germany and Switzerland for the realization of post-processors.

Parts and associated models are susceptible to be changed during the production stage. Thanks to TopSolid's integrated product line any changes made to a model designed with TopSolid'Design are automatically recognized and taken into account by TopSolid'Cam. All the operator needs to do is refresh his operations for the changes to be taken into account.
What happens in the case of imported parts? Such parts are also "living" and can thus be modified!! Many parts which are machined using TopSolid'Cam have not in fact been designed using TopSolid'Design. This does not mean, however, that the link between design and manufacturing is broken. Thanks to TopSolid'Cam's topological recognition features any changes made between the original model and the modified model can be detected and thus the subsequent machining operations are accordingly adapted.
